x86/mm: Allow memevent responses to be signaled via the event channel
Don't require a separate domctl to notify the memevent interface that an event
has occured. This domctl can be taxing, particularly when you are scaling
events and paging to many domains across a single system. Instead, we use the
existing event channel to signal when we place something in the ring (as per
normal ring operation).
